About

Wanlin Dai is a scholar working on Electrical and Electronic Engineering, Electrochemistry and Polymers and Plastics. According to data from OpenAlex, Wanlin Dai has authored 15 papers receiving a total of 812 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Electrical and Electronic Engineering, 9 papers in Electrochemistry and 5 papers in Polymers and Plastics. Recurrent topics in Wanlin Dai’s work include Electrochemical sensors and biosensors (10 papers), Electrochemical Analysis and Applications (9 papers) and Conducting polymers and applications (5 papers). Wanlin Dai is often cited by papers focused on Electrochemical sensors and biosensors (10 papers), Electrochemical Analysis and Applications (9 papers) and Conducting polymers and applications (5 papers). Wanlin Dai collaborates with scholars based in China, Hong Kong and Japan. Wanlin Dai's co-authors include Jianshan Ye, Zhiwei Lu, Junjun Zhang, Weihua Cai, Baichen Liu, Ting Lai, Jiaping Ye, Xue-Ni Lin, Guangquan Mo and Wu Lan and has published in prestigious journals such as Journal of Power Sources, Journal of Colloid and Interface Science and Electrochimica Acta.
